The Better Being Co is a whole-body wellness platform that develops, manufactures, markets, and distributes trusted and beneficial vitamins, supplements, minerals, and personal care products. Its core brands include Solaray, KAL, Zhou, Nu U, Heritage Store, Life Flo, and Zand Immunity.
